Funkcja JEŻELI to jedna z najważniejszych formuł w Excelu – pozwala podejmować decyzje na podstawie danych. Czy uczeń zaliczył? Czy cel został osiągnięty? Czy zamówienie spełnia warunki? W tym poradniku poznasz JEŻELI od podstaw, zagnieżdżanie wielu warunków oraz połączenia z funkcjami ORAZ i LUB.
Składnia funkcji JEŻELI
Funkcja JEŻELI ma trzy argumenty:
=JEŻELI(warunek; wartość_jeśli_prawda; wartość_jeśli_fałsz)
- warunek – co sprawdzamy (np. C3>50)
- wartość_jeśli_prawda – co się pojawi, gdy warunek jest spełniony
- wartość_jeśli_fałsz – co się pojawi, gdy warunek nie jest spełniony

Ważne: Tekst w formule zawsze wpisujemy w cudzysłów (np. „zaliczone”). Liczby – bez cudzysłowu.
Przykład 1 – zaliczone czy niezaliczone?
Mamy listę uczniów z punktacją. Jeśli ktoś zdobył więcej niż 50 punktów – zaliczone, w przeciwnym razie – niezaliczone:
=JEŻELI(C3>50;"zaliczone";"niezaliczone")

Po napisaniu formuły dla pierwszego wiersza, przeciągnij ją w dół za mały kwadracik w prawym dolnym rogu komórki – Excel automatycznie dostosuje odniesienia.
Pro tip: Możesz też użyć konstruktora formuł (przycisk fx obok paska formuły). W konstruktorze nie musisz wpisywać cudzysłowów ręcznie – Excel doda je automatycznie.
JEŻELI dla tekstu
Funkcja JEŻELI działa też z tekstem. Przykład: jeśli status zamówienia to „wysłane”, pokaż „OK”, w przeciwnym razie „do sprawdzenia”:
=JEŻELI(B3="wysłane";"OK";"do sprawdzenia")
Zwróć uwagę na znak = (równa się) zamiast > (większe niż) – przy porównywaniu tekstu sprawdzamy równość.
Zagnieżdżanie JEŻELI – wiele warunków
Co jeśli masz kilka progów ocen? Np. powyżej 70 pkt = ocena 5, powyżej 60 = 4, powyżej 50 = 3, reszta = 2? Wtedy zagnieżdżasz kolejne funkcje JEŻELI:

Uwaga – kolejność warunków ma znaczenie!
Częsty błąd: Jeśli zaczniesz od warunku C3>40, to każdy uczeń z punktacją powyżej 40 dostanie ocenę 2, bo Excel zatrzymuje się na pierwszym spełnionym warunku i nie sprawdza kolejnych.
Poprawnie: Sprawdzaj warunki od największego do najmniejszego:
=JEŻELI(C3>70;5;JEŻELI(C3>60;4;JEŻELI(C3>50;3;2)))

Zasada: Zamykasz tyle nawiasów, ile masz funkcji JEŻELI w formule.
JEŻELI + ORAZ – oba warunki muszą być spełnione
Czasem potrzebujesz sprawdzić dwa warunki jednocześnie. Np. zaliczenie wymaga punktacji >40 i frekwencji >60%:
=JEŻELI(ORAZ(C3>40;D3>60%);"zaliczone";"niezaliczone")
Funkcja ORAZ zwraca PRAWDA tylko wtedy, gdy wszystkie warunki są spełnione. Jeśli choćby jeden nie jest – FAŁSZ.

JEŻELI + LUB – wystarczy jeden warunek
A co jeśli wystarczy spełnić jeden z dwóch warunków? Np. zaliczenie gdy punktacja >40 lub frekwencja >80%:
=JEŻELI(LUB(C3>40;D3>80%);"zaliczone";"niezaliczone")
Funkcja LUB zwraca PRAWDA, gdy przynajmniej jeden warunek jest spełniony.

Porównanie: ORAZ vs LUB
| Funkcja | Kiedy PRAWDA | Przykład |
|---|---|---|
| ORAZ | Wszystkie warunki spełnione | Punkty >40 I frekwencja >60% |
| LUB | Przynajmniej jeden spełniony | Punkty >40 LUB frekwencja >80% |
Podsumowanie
Funkcja JEŻELI to fundament pracy z warunkami w Excelu. Pamiętaj:
- Tekst w cudzysłowie, liczby bez
- Przy zagnieżdżaniu – warunki od największego do najmniejszego
- ORAZ = wszystkie warunki muszą być spełnione
- LUB = wystarczy jeden warunek
Chcesz sprawdzić swoją wiedzę z Excela? Pobierz darmowy test z 15 zadaniami i przekonaj się, na jakim jesteś poziomie!
